Im sure some of you seen my other thread. i have all the parts i need and I'm just waiting for the reamer to show up. Now Ive started the search for load data. I've read to start with .264 win mag loads and then 12% reduction of 7mm stw loads. I'm looking for more definite load data where would you guys start? thanks Caleb

Muzzle to butt

muzzle brake- Muscle break
barrel- 26" bartlien
action- post 64 model 70 started life as 270 weatherby
trigger- jewell
stock- HS precision

haven't decided which scope I'm going to put on it permanently for now i have a viper hs 4-16x50 that will do the trick for a while I'm leaning towards night force's new shv

Im still waiting of the reamer to show up so my smith can put all the pieces together.
